**Alert: Intermittent DNS resolution failures (Skylark resolver pool)**

Fires when more than 2% of lookups from the Skylark resolver pool time out over five minutes. Usually caused by a stale upstream forwarder after a node rotation, not an outage. Restarting the affected resolver typically clears it. Historical occurrences and the diagnostic walkthrough are recorded on the internal page here.

wiki page, tahaf-tajog: https://jira.ordindyn.corp/pipeline

INTERNAL MEMO — Branch Managers

Re: Warranty-Cost Overrun

Warranty claims on the Ferrowax pump series are running 31% over budget this quarter. Root cause traced to a seal batch from the Oldcote plant. Immediate actions: halt goodwill repairs beyond standard terms, log all claims through the central register, and escalate repeat failures. Replacement inventory ships to affected branches next week. Cost recovery discussions with the supplier are underway. Broader implications are set out in the note below.

board note of bawep-tajef: Queniusek Systems plans to raise the Quenvan list price by 53.1 percent in March. The pricing group signed off on a budget of $176.4 million for Project Drueth. The renewal with Casionix Partners closes at $142.5 million a year, 8.3 percent below the last contract. Project Fraax slips by six weeks because of the tooling delay.

**Vendor note: Inkmill markdown pipeline**

Rendering for Parchway docs is outsourced to Inkmill under an annual contract, renewing each March. They handle sanitization and PDF export; we own the upload queue. SLA: 4-hour response on rendering failures. Escalate only after two failed retries. Their support desk is reachable at the address below.

billing contact of hahaf-baguf = zorael.tammir.jorius@sivrelhq.internal

For contractors joining the Mistlewood digest project: the batch email scheduler's old setting `DIGEST_CRON_WINDOW` has been renamed to `DIGEST_DISPATCH_WINDOW` to match the dispatcher service's terminology. The old name still works but logs a deprecation warning and will be removed in 4.0. Please update any env files you've copied from earlier branches, and double-check the timezone suffix — several missed digests last quarter traced back to that. The dispatcher also authenticates to the mail relay, so your env file needs this line:

secret setting of bageg-bagag: ARCHIVE_KEY3=e2f